Arlene Grigsby

Moro |

Arlene R. Grigsby, 92, passed away at 7:09 pm Saturday September 26, 2020 at Jerseyville Manor Nursing Home in Jerseyville.

She was born on June 2, 1928 in Harrisburg, PA, the daughter of John & Annie (Gloss) Rhine.

Arlene married James Grigsby on July 12, 1946 in Alton, IL and he preceded her in death on July 10, 2007.

She was a member of the First Southern Baptist Church of Meadowbrook and loved being a cosmetologist.  She had lots of close friends and loved dogs and animals.

Arlene is survived by two sons and a daughter-in-law, Steven & Debra Grigsby of Powder Springs, GA and Michael Grigsby of Godfrey; four grandchildren and spouse, Tara (James) Singleton of McAlister, OK, Brittany Grigsby of Powder Springs, GA,  Christopher Grigsby of Collinsville, Jamie Grigsby of Alton, Lindsey (Tyler) St.Clair of Bridgeton, MO and several great grandchildren.

In addition to her husband and parents, she was also preceded in death by a brother and sister-in-law, Herman & Sarah Rhine.
